Manufacturing process audit checklist

Here’s a general manufacturing process audit checklist that can be customized based on the specific processes, industry standards, and regulatory requirements applicable to your organization:

  1. Process Documentation and Control:
    • Are process flowcharts, SOPs, work instructions, and other relevant documentation available and up-to-date?
    • Is there a documented change control process for updating procedures?
    • Are employees trained on the latest procedures?
  2. Equipment and Facilities:
    • Are equipment and machinery properly maintained and calibrated?
    • Is there a preventive maintenance schedule in place?
    • Are safety features installed and operational?
    • Is the production area clean and organized?
  3. Raw Material Handling and Storage:
    • Are raw materials stored in appropriate conditions to prevent contamination or degradation?
    • Is there a first-in-first-out (FIFO) system in place to manage inventory?
    • Are materials properly labeled and identified?
  4. Production Process:
    • Is the production process consistent with approved procedures?
    • Are there adequate controls to ensure product quality and consistency?
    • Are critical process parameters monitored and documented?
    • Is there a system for tracking production batches or lots?
  5. Quality Control and Assurance:
    • Are quality control checks performed at key stages of the production process?
    • Are inspection records maintained?
    • Is there a process for handling non-conforming products?
    • Are quality metrics monitored and analyzed for trends?
  6. Employee Training and Competence:
    • Are employees trained on relevant procedures, safety protocols, and quality standards?
    • Are competency assessments conducted periodically?
    • Are training records maintained?
  7. Health and Safety:
    • Are safety protocols followed by employees?
    • Are personal protective equipment (PPE) provided and used where required?
    • Are emergency procedures clearly communicated and practiced?
  8. Environmental Compliance:
    • Are environmental regulations complied with, such as waste disposal and emissions control?
    • Are there measures in place to minimize environmental impact?
  9. Supplier Management:
    • Are suppliers evaluated and monitored for quality and reliability?
    • Is there a process for handling supplier non-conformities?
  10. Continuous Improvement:
    • Are there mechanisms in place for identifying and implementing process improvements?
    • Are feedback mechanisms available for employees to suggest improvements?
    • Are lessons learned from previous audits or incidents incorporated into the improvement process?

Manufacturing process audit checklistRemember, this manufacturing process audit checklist is not exhaustive and should be tailored to suit the specific processes, industry requirements, and organizational priorities. Regular review and updates to the checklist based on audit findings and changing conditions are essential to ensure its effectiveness.
